Comparison review

The Samsung Galaxy Tab A7 Lite has an overall score of 74.2, which is way better than Galaxy Tab Wi-Fi's global score of 56.4. These devices use Android OS (Operating System), but Samsung Galaxy Tab A7 Lite has 11 version and Galaxy Tab Wi-Fi has Android 2.2, so it provides the user a couple nice extra features. Samsung Galaxy Tab A7 Lite is a just a bit lighter and thinner tablet than Galaxy Tab Wi-Fi.

The Galaxy Tab A7 Lite counts with a much greater processing power than Galaxy Tab Wi-Fi, because it has more RAM memory and 7 more CPU cores. The Samsung Galaxy Tab Wi-Fi has a bit sharper display than Galaxy Tab A7 Lite, although it has a little bit smaller screen, a way worse resolution of 600 x 1024px and a bit lower display density.

The Galaxy Tab A7 Lite has a very superior storage capacity to store more apps and games than Samsung Galaxy Tab Wi-Fi, because it has 32 GB internal storage and a slot for an SD memory card that holds up to 1 TB. Galaxy Tab A7 Lite features improved battery performance than Samsung Galaxy Tab Wi-Fi, because it has a 5100mAh battery size.

The Samsung Galaxy Tab A7 Lite features a greater camera than Galaxy Tab Wi-Fi, because it has a way higher resolution camera in the back and a lot better 1920x1080 (Full HD) video definition.

Despite of being the best tablet of the ones we compare here, Galaxy Tab A7 Lite is also by far the cheapest one, making it an obvious call.
